About Medical Malpractice Law in Admiralty, Singapore:

Medical malpractice refers to situations where a healthcare provider, such as a doctor or hospital, fails to provide proper treatment to a patient, resulting in harm or injury. In Admiralty, Singapore, medical malpractice cases are governed by specific laws and regulations to protect both patients and healthcare providers.

Local Laws Overview:

In Admiralty, Singapore, medical malpractice cases fall under the laws related to negligence and professional misconduct. Healthcare providers are held to a high standard of care and are expected to adhere to strict guidelines and protocols when treating patients. Victims of medical malpractice have the right to seek compensation for any harm or injury suffered as a result of negligence.

Frequently Asked Questions:

What is considered medical malpractice in Admiralty, Singapore?

Medical malpractice includes situations where healthcare providers fail to provide proper treatment, make errors in diagnosis or treatment, or act negligently, resulting in harm or injury to the patient.

How can I prove medical malpractice in Admiralty, Singapore?

You can prove medical malpractice by gathering evidence such as medical records, expert opinions, and witness statements to demonstrate that the healthcare provider failed to meet the standard of care expected in the medical profession.

What compensation can I receive for medical malpractice in Admiralty, Singapore?

Victims of medical malpractice may be entitled to compensation for medical expenses, loss of income, pain and suffering, and other damages resulting from the negligence of the healthcare provider.

What is the time limit to file a medical malpractice claim in Admiralty, Singapore?

The time limit to file a medical malpractice claim in Admiralty, Singapore is typically 3 years from the date of the negligent act or omission, or from the date the victim becomes aware of the negligence.

Can I file a medical malpractice claim on behalf of a deceased family member in Admiralty, Singapore?

Yes, certain family members or dependents may be able to file a medical malpractice claim on behalf of a deceased family member in Admiralty, Singapore, seeking compensation for the harm or injury suffered.
